ATLANTA, GA– DeKalb County will host a public memorial service for Master Firefighter Preston Fant on Thursday, Sept. 18.
Firefighter Fant’s body will lie in state beginning at 1 p.m., with the memorial service scheduled to begin at 2 p.m. at Truist Park, 755 Battery Ave., S.E., Atlanta.
Firefighter Fant died in the line of duty trying to save a colleague while battling a warehouse fire in Stone Mountain on Sept. 8. He was 53.
Fant, a 21-year veteran firefighter, is survived by his wife and five children.
The memorial service is open to the public. The service also will be livestreamed at www.dctvchannel23.tv for those unable to attend in person.
